The Young Violinist's Repertoire is the ideal introduction to the literature of the violin. Its four books bring together music from all over Europe and from all periods - they are progressively arranged to take the young player from the very early stages to an intermediate standard. All the pieces in Book 1 are in first position. It includes music by Bach, Haydn, Beethoven, Mozart and many others.
Published by Faber Music.
This volume is on the ABRSM Bowed Strings Syllabus 2019-2023 and is one of the alternative pieces on the syllabus.
